I started by stamping the sentiment from Stampin’ Up A Little Lace Cling Stamp Set in Soft Suede Ink on the bottom of an Old Olive card front. I embossed the card front using the Woodland Embossing Folder and added 3 Gold Metallic Pearls to the top.

I embossed a small panel of Grapefruit Grove card stock using the Subtle 3D Embossing Folder and then adhered it to a Cajun Craze mat using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.  I adhered the matted panel to the card front using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.  I wrapped a piece of the Old Olive/Pretty Peacock 3/8″ Reversible Ribbon around the card front and using Multipurpose Liquid Glue I adhered the card front to an Old Olive card base.

On a small panel of Whisper White cardstock I stamped the tree image from the Stampin’ Up Natures Beauty Cling Stamp Set (available Sept 4) in Soft Suede Ink a couple of times.  Using my Stamping Sponges I sponged the Whisper White panel using my Grapefruit Grove Ink on the top and Old Olive Ink on the bottom.   Using the grass image from the Natures Beauty stamp set I stamped some grass around the bottom sponged area in Old Olive Ink.  I adhered the sponged panel to a Cajun Craze mat using Snail.  On a small piece of Whisper White cardstock I stamped the fox image from the Natures Beauty stamp set in Cajun Craze Ink and fussy cut the image out using my Paper Snips.  I adhered the fox to the sponged panel using Stampin’ Dimensionals and adhered the panel to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als.  I cut a leaf out of Cajun Craze cardstock using the Gathered Leaves Dies (available Sept 4).  I adhered the leaf to the card front using Stampin’ Dimensionals and a Glue Dot.

On the inside I stamped the fox image from the Natures Beauty stamp set in Cajun Craze Ink, stamping off once, on the bottom of a Whisper White panel.  I stamped the tree image from the Natures Beauty stamp set in Soft Suede Ink, stamping off twice, 3 times across the middle of the Whisper White panel.  I stamped the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up A Big Thank You Photopolymer Stamp Set in Soft Suede Ink in the center of the Whisper White panel.  I adhered the Whisper White panel to a Cajun Craze mat using Snail and then to the inside of the Old Olive card base using Multipurpose Liquid Glue.

To finish my card I decorated a Medium Whisper White Envelope.  I stamped the fox image from the Natures Beauty stamp set in Cajun Craze Ink on the envelope front.  I stamped the tree images from the Natures Beauty stamp set in Soft Suede Ink, some full strength and some stamped off, across the envelope flap.

Card stock cuts for this project:

  • Cajun Craze Cardstock 2 3/8″ X 2 5/8″ (artwork mat), 2 3/8″ X 3 1/8″ (grapefurit grove mat), 4 1/8″ X 5 3/8″ (inner liner mat)
  • Grapefruit Grove Cardstock 2 1/4″ X 3″ (card front panel)
  • Old Olive Cardstock 4 1/4″ X 11″ (card base scored and folded at 5 1/2″), 4 1/8″ X 5 3/8″ (card front)
  • Whisper White Cardstock 2 1/4″ X 2 1/2″ (artwork), 4″ X 5 1/4″ (inner liner)
